National dialogue 2.0 ... the last throw of the dice?

IT IS A common cause that 31 years since the formal demise of apartheid, the promises, great expectations and dreams of democracy are rapidly turning into horrific nightmares for the poor and disadvantaged. At the same time, (new and old) elites rule the roost.
Socio-economic and spatial inequalities of the apartheid era widened, while the politically-connected continued to accumulate wealth and power at the expense of the poor.
Crime and corruption escalate exponentially and are inextricably connected to political elites, global mafia operations of every genre magnetically gravitate to our country, and gender-based violence is a pandemic.
South Africa has one of the highest unemployment rates in the world (33%), especially among young adults.
The poor have inadequate access to essential services like water, electricity, health care and basic education.
Many of these challenges were aggravated by state capture. As highlighted by the Zondo Commission, state capture in South Africa involved the systematic and deliberate subversion of state-owned enterprises (SOEs) for private gain.
State capture eroded good governance practices within SOEs and government departments (including law enforcement and intelligence services), decreasing operational performance and effectiveness.
This entailed influencing appointments, procurement procedures, governance and institutional structures to favour specific individuals and organisations.
Key SOEs like Eskom, Transnet and South African Airways were significantly impacted by state capture, with subsequent multiplier effects on all aspects of South African life, destroying the economy.
All these problems and challenges were aggravated during the hegemonic rule and reign of one political party, the ANC.
Not surprisingly, some of its senior members were implicated in the state capture report. Still, no one has yet been convicted because of the hollowing out of capacity in the National Prosecuting Authority.
When he was firmly ensconced on the throne, Jacob Zuma repeatedly said that the “ANC will rule until Jesus returns”.
